What makes a newspaper popular is its subject matter, its visual appeal, and commenting on events for as long as possible.
Explanation:
Newspapers are the main source of information worldwide. Although today most of the people access the news through television or the internet, most of this news is in turn taken from the main newspapers in the area of influence.
For this reason, it is necessary that the newspapers develop their news in an appropriate way, which will give them the popularity necessary to capture the majority of public opinion through their news.
In this sense, some parameters to generate a greater impact and capture a greater part of the public are, among others, the treatment of matters of general interest and broad public knowledge; the use of visual strategies that generate immediate impact and interest; and the development of news in a comprehensive and complete way.
